Episode narrativeepisode_narrativeVeering southerly flow ahead of an approaching cold front helped to advect a rich plume of low-level moisture across South Florida. As showers and thunderstorms associated with the front pushed through the area and stalled, this translated into heavy rainfall and flooding across east coast metro. Also, lightning strikes from one storm struck and damaged the Broward Water Treatment Plant.
Event narrativeevent_narrativeLightning struck the Broward County 2A Water Treatment Plant located on Copans Road in Pompano Beach. The lightning damaged a number of mechanical, electrical, and instrumentation components including a high service pump, the control modules for two electronically actuated valves, and two programable logic controllers. The failure of this combination of items impeded their ability to fully pressurize the potable water distribution system, resulting in a precautionary boil water order to portions of Broward County.
